Position Overview:
Full-time role in the Fostering Connections Program Child Assessment Center and Child Assessment Team Clinic. Seeking someone passionate about supporting children in out-of-home placements or who have experienced maltreatment. Role requires travel to Northern Lights Westside and Eastland locations. Prior experience with trauma-informed care is preferred. This position is Exempt and involves collaboration with a multidisciplinary team to provide child-centered care.
